Objective

Want your website to be accessible via your domain name? To do this, your domain name must point to the IP address of the service your website is located on (web hosting plan, dedicated server, VPS, etc.). You will then need to configure your domain name’s active DNS zone using a type AAAA DNS record.

Find out how to add an DNS AAAA record to an OVHcloud DNS zone for your domain name.

Instructions

Adding, modifying or deleting DNS records in an active DNS zone can cause service interruptions. If in doubt, contact a specialist provider.

Add an DNS AAAA record for a domain name

  1. Click the DNS zones menu, then choose the domain name concerned.
  2. On the page that appears, click Add an entry.
  3. In the window that opens, select the field of type AAAA.
  4. Then enter the IP address (e.g.: 2001:db8:1:1b00:203:0:113:0) of the service your website is hosted on (web hosting plan, dedicated server, VPS, etc.) in the Target * field, and click Next.
  5. Check the summary, then click Confirm. It takes up to 24 hours for the change to propagate fully over the DNS network.

Add an DNS AAAA record for a domain name subdomain

  1. Click the DNS zones menu, then choose the domain name concerned.
  2. On the page that appears, click Add an entry.
  3. In the window that opens, select the field of type AAAA.
  4. Then enter the subdomain in the Sub-domain field (e.g.: www for the subdomain www.domain.tld), and the IP address in the Target * field (e.g.: 2001:db8:1:1b00:203:0:113:0) of the service your website is located on (web hosting, dedicated server, VPS, etc.). Finally, click Next.
  5. Check the summary, then click Confirm. It takes up to 24 hours for the change to propagate fully over the DNS network.
